What are some common challenges faced by phlebotomists working in outpatient clinics, and how can they be addressed?

Phlebotomists in outpatient clinics often encounter challenges such as managing a high patient volume, working with patients who have difficult veins or are anxious about blood draws, and maintaining accuracy under time constraints. To address these, strong communication sk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in a variety of blood draw techniques are essential. Building rapport with patients, staying organized, and collaborating closely with nurses and laboratory staff can help ensure efficient and compassionate care.

How can I become a mobile phlebotomy app?

To become a mobile phlebotomist, you need to complete a phlebotomy training program and obtain certification, such as the Certified Phlebotomy Technician (CPT) credential. Gaining experience in blood collection and developing strong patient communication skills are essential, and some positions may require a valid driver's license for travel between locations.

Responsibility:
• Prepare the Cardiovascular Operating Room (CVOR) before procedures by ensuring instruments, supplies, and equipment are available and sterile.
• Scrub and assist surgeons during open-heart, vascular, and other cardiac surgical procedures.
• Maintain a sterile field throughout the operation and follow infection control protocols.
• Anticipate the surgeon's needs by passing instruments, sutures, and supplies efficiently during procedures.
• Prepare and operate specialized cardiac surgical equipment as needed.
• Participate in the cardiac call rotation and respond promptly when called in for emergency or scheduled cardiac cases.
• Assist with non-cardiac surgical cases when there are no CVOR procedures scheduled.
• Perform instrument counts before, during, and after surgery to ensure patient safety.
